VSI crusher. Vertical shaft impactors (VSI) have a vertical shaft and enclosed rotor that turn at high speeds. There are two main types of VSI crushers, rock-on-rock (autogenous) and shoe and anvil. Rock-on-rock crushers have pockets filled with rock lining the entire circumference of the chamber. Shoe and anvil VSI crushers have composite ...


What is the difference between Impact Crusher and Cone Crusher?

In general, impact crushers both vertical shaft (VSI) and horizontal shaft (HSI), the main difference from the cone crusher is the type of crushing force. The impact crusher crush by material impacting another object. The cone crusher uses compression crushing to squeeze or compress the material between the two crushing surfaces.
